Environmental Impact of Improper Car Wash Water Disposal
Improper disposal of car wash water can have severe environmental consequences. When car wash water is released into storm drains or waterways, it can carry pollutants and contaminants that can harm aquatic life. Soap and other chemicals in car wash water can also cause foam and suds to form, which can deplete the oxygen in water and harm aquatic plants and animals. Additionally, car wash water can contain heavy metals and other toxic substances that can accumulate in soil and groundwater, posing a risk to human health and the environment.
According to the United States Environmental Protection Agency (EPA), car wash water can contain high levels of pollutants, including suspended solids, oil and grease, and heavy metals. The EPA estimates that a single car wash can generate up to 100 gallons of wastewater, which can contain up to 10 pounds of pollutants. If this wastewater is not disposed of properly, it can contaminate soil, groundwater, and surface water, posing a risk to human health and the environment.
Regulations and Guidelines for Car Wash Water Disposal
There are various regulations and guidelines that govern the disposal of car wash water. In the United States, the EPA regulates the disposal of car wash water under the Clean Water Act, which prohibits the discharge of pollutants into waterways without a permit. The EPA also provides guidelines for the proper disposal of car wash water, including the use of oil-water separators, sedimentation tanks, and other treatment systems.
In addition to federal regulations, many states and local governments have their own regulations and guidelines for car wash water disposal. For example, some states require car washes to obtain permits before discharging wastewater into waterways, while others require car washes to use specific treatment systems or technologies. It is essential for car wash owners and operators to familiarize themselves with the regulations and guidelines in their area to ensure compliance and prevent environmental harm.

Methods for Treating and Disposing of Car Wash Water
There are several methods for treating and disposing of car wash water, including physical, chemical, and biological treatment systems. The choice of treatment system will depend on the type and amount of pollutants present in the car wash water, as well as the regulatory requirements in the area.
Physical Treatment Systems
Physical treatment systems use physical processes, such as sedimentation and filtration, to remove pollutants and contaminants from car wash water. These systems are often used to remove suspended solids, oil, and grease from car wash water. Examples of physical treatment systems include:
- Sedimentation tanks, which use gravity to remove suspended solids and other pollutants
- Oil-water separators, which use gravity to separate oil and grease from car wash water
- Filtration systems, which use filters to remove suspended solids and other pollutants
Physical treatment systems are often used in combination with other treatment systems, such as chemical or biological treatment systems, to provide a comprehensive treatment process.
Chemical Treatment Systems
Chemical treatment systems use chemicals to remove pollutants and contaminants from car wash water. These systems are often used to remove heavy metals, oil, and grease from car wash water. Examples of chemical treatment systems include:
- Chemical precipitation, which uses chemicals to precipitate out heavy metals and other pollutants
- Coagulation and flocculation, which use chemicals to remove suspended solids and other pollutants
- Disinfection, which uses chemicals to kill bacteria and other microorganisms
Chemical treatment systems are often used in combination with other treatment systems, such as physical or biological treatment systems, to provide a comprehensive treatment process.
Biological Treatment Systems
Biological treatment systems use living organisms, such as bacteria and other microorganisms, to remove pollutants and contaminants from car wash water. These systems are often used to remove organic pollutants, such as soap and other chemicals, from car wash water. Examples of biological treatment systems include:
- Aerobic treatment systems, which use oxygen to support the growth of microorganisms
- Anaerobic treatment systems, which use the absence of oxygen to support the growth of microorganisms
- Bioreactors, which use microorganisms to break down pollutants and contaminants
Biological treatment systems are often used in combination with other treatment systems, such as physical or chemical treatment systems, to provide a comprehensive treatment process.
| Treatment System | Description | Advantages | Disadvantages |
|---|---|---|---|
| Physical Treatment Systems | Use physical processes to remove pollutants | Low cost, easy to operate | May not remove all pollutants |
| Chemical Treatment Systems | Use chemicals to remove pollutants | Effective at removing heavy metals and other pollutants | Can be expensive, may produce hazardous byproducts |
| Biological Treatment Systems | Use living organisms to remove pollutants | Effective at removing organic pollutants, low cost | May require specialized equipment and expertise |

Can I dispose of car wash water in a storm drain?
No, it’s not recommended to dispose of car wash water in a storm drain. Storm drains are designed to carry rainwater and other non-polluted water into nearby waterways, and disposing of car wash water in a storm drain can contaminate the water and harm aquatic life. Car wash water can contain pollutants such as soap, detergents, and heavy metals, which can be harmful to the environment. Instead, you should dispose of car wash water through a sanitary sewer or a designated car wash wastewater collection system, or use a car wash water recycling system to treat and filter the water on-site.
